Property |
Value |
dbo:abstract
|
- Hindley-Milner (HM) ist ein Verfahren der Typinferenz mit parametrischem Polymorphismus für den Lambda-Kalkül. Es wurde erstmals von J. Roger Hindley beschrieben und später von Robin Milner wiederentdeckt.Luis Damas trug eine genaue formale Analyse und einen Beweis der Methode in seiner Doktorarbeit bei, weshalb das Verfahren auch als Damas-Milner bezeichnet wird. Unter den herausragenden Eigenschaften des HM sind Vollständigkeit und die Fähigkeit, den allgemeinsten Typ einer gegebenen Quelle ohne Hinzunahme von Annotationen oder sonstigen Hinweisen bestimmen zu können. HM ist ein effizientes Verfahren, das die Typisierung nahezu in linearer Zeit bzgl. der Größe der Quelle ermitteln kann, womit es praktisch zum Typisieren großer Programme anwendbar ist. HM wird bevorzugt in funktionalen Sprachen eingesetzt. Es wurde erstmals als Teil des Typsystems der Programmiersprache ML implementiert. Seitdem wurde HM auf verschiedene Weise erweitert, insbesondere durch beschränkte Typen, wie sie in Haskell verwendet werden. (de)
- Hindley-Milner (HM) ist ein Verfahren der Typinferenz mit parametrischem Polymorphismus für den Lambda-Kalkül. Es wurde erstmals von J. Roger Hindley beschrieben und später von Robin Milner wiederentdeckt.Luis Damas trug eine genaue formale Analyse und einen Beweis der Methode in seiner Doktorarbeit bei, weshalb das Verfahren auch als Damas-Milner bezeichnet wird. Unter den herausragenden Eigenschaften des HM sind Vollständigkeit und die Fähigkeit, den allgemeinsten Typ einer gegebenen Quelle ohne Hinzunahme von Annotationen oder sonstigen Hinweisen bestimmen zu können. HM ist ein effizientes Verfahren, das die Typisierung nahezu in linearer Zeit bzgl. der Größe der Quelle ermitteln kann, womit es praktisch zum Typisieren großer Programme anwendbar ist. HM wird bevorzugt in funktionalen Sprachen eingesetzt. Es wurde erstmals als Teil des Typsystems der Programmiersprache ML implementiert. Seitdem wurde HM auf verschiedene Weise erweitert, insbesondere durch beschränkte Typen, wie sie in Haskell verwendet werden. (de)
|
dbo:wikiPageID
| |
dbo:wikiPageRevisionID
| |
dct:subject
| |
rdfs:comment
|
- Hindley-Milner (HM) ist ein Verfahren der Typinferenz mit parametrischem Polymorphismus für den Lambda-Kalkül. Es wurde erstmals von J. Roger Hindley beschrieben und später von Robin Milner wiederentdeckt.Luis Damas trug eine genaue formale Analyse und einen Beweis der Methode in seiner Doktorarbeit bei, weshalb das Verfahren auch als Damas-Milner bezeichnet wird. Unter den herausragenden Eigenschaften des HM sind Vollständigkeit und die Fähigkeit, den allgemeinsten Typ einer gegebenen Quelle ohne Hinzunahme von Annotationen oder sonstigen Hinweisen bestimmen zu können. HM ist ein effizientes Verfahren, das die Typisierung nahezu in linearer Zeit bzgl. der Größe der Quelle ermitteln kann, womit es praktisch zum Typisieren großer Programme anwendbar ist. HM wird bevorzugt in funktionalen Sp (de)
- Hindley-Milner (HM) ist ein Verfahren der Typinferenz mit parametrischem Polymorphismus für den Lambda-Kalkül. Es wurde erstmals von J. Roger Hindley beschrieben und später von Robin Milner wiederentdeckt.Luis Damas trug eine genaue formale Analyse und einen Beweis der Methode in seiner Doktorarbeit bei, weshalb das Verfahren auch als Damas-Milner bezeichnet wird. Unter den herausragenden Eigenschaften des HM sind Vollständigkeit und die Fähigkeit, den allgemeinsten Typ einer gegebenen Quelle ohne Hinzunahme von Annotationen oder sonstigen Hinweisen bestimmen zu können. HM ist ein effizientes Verfahren, das die Typisierung nahezu in linearer Zeit bzgl. der Größe der Quelle ermitteln kann, womit es praktisch zum Typisieren großer Programme anwendbar ist. HM wird bevorzugt in funktionalen Sp (de)
|
rdfs:label
|
- Typinferenz nach Hindley-Milner (de)
- Typinferenz nach Hindley-Milner (de)
|
owl:sameAs
| |
prov:wasDerivedFrom
| |
foaf:isPrimaryTopicOf
| |
is dbo:wikiPageDisambiguates
of | |
is dbo:wikiPageRedirects
of | |
is foaf:primaryTopic
of | |